Discover Changshu: A Tranquil Treasure Hidden in Jiangnan, the Perfect Alternative to Suzhou

Are you longing to escape the crowds and find a secret haven filled with Jiangnan charm? Changshu, a city whose name may sound familiar yet few have personally explored, is your ideal choice. It's not suited for rushed "commando-style" tourism, but rather deserves a leisurely pace as you stroll through its streets. Here, time seems to stand still, and life's rhythm slows to the extreme, allowing your restless heart to find complete healing. Changshu, named for its "fertile soil that suffers neither flood nor drought," is an important birthplace of Wu culture where the essence of "Jiangnan water town" is displayed in its fullest glory. Unlike heavily commercialized scenic areas, Changshu's water towns remain authentic. Walking through the old town, you'll unexpectedly encounter ancient streets and towns reminiscent of Shantang Street or Zhouzhuang. These historically rich places aren't merely tourist attractions but continue to be home to residents—stepping into them feels like traveling back in time. As a county-level city of Suzhou, Changshu perfectly preserves the essence of Suzhou's classical gardens. Eleven of Changshu's gardens are listed in the "Suzhou Gardens Directory." More remarkably, visitors here are few, creating a stark contrast to the crowded and noisy gardens in Suzhou. Here, you can truly appreciate the unique charm of Suzhou gardens, where scenes change with every step. All you see is pure beauty, without bustling crowds and noise—the gardens return to their most authentic state. 3-Day 2-Night In-Depth Tour Guide Day 1: Experience the Ancient City's Heritage Visit the Ancient City Scenic Area in the morning to explore historical traces. In the afternoon, stroll through Fangta Park to admire the Xingfu Temple Pagoda (Square Pagoda), a national key cultural relic protection site and Changshu's iconic landmark, as well as a precious example of early Chinese feng shui towers. In the evening, enter Yan Garden to experience peaceful moments in a classical garden. Day 2: Embrace Lake Views and Mountain Scenery Dedicate the entire day to Shanghu Scenic Area. Enjoy the lake and mountain views along the Shanghu Lake Road, where the 800-hectare lake with its rippling waters complements the ten-mile Yushan Mountain, creating a stunning three-dimensional landscape painting. Don't miss visiting Fushui Mountain Villa, which witnessed the moving love story between Qian Qianyi and Liu Rushi, the foremost of the "Eight Beauties of Qinhuai" during the late Ming and early Qing dynasties. The Water Forest is another must-see, with over 300 acres forming the largest ecological wetland forest in East China. Ride bamboo rafts through it to witness the magical sight of "fish swimming above trees and birds flying in water," far from worldly noise. Afterward, head to Qinhu Xili to experience the unique atmosphere where modern and classical styles merge. Day 3: Climb Yushan Mountain for Panoramic Views Head to Yushan Scenic Area and climb Yushan Mountain for a panoramic view of Changshu. Explore the Western City Tower Scenic Area, one of the famous "Eighteen Scenes of Yushan," featuring attractions like Zhidao Temple, Dashishan House, and Dongyue Temple. The Ming Dynasty city walls and battlements stand tall, creating an extraordinary atmosphere. Recommended Key Attractions - Fangta Park: ★★★★★ The Xingfu Temple Pagoda, as the core structure in the park, carries rich historical and cultural significance and offers an excellent window into Changshu's ancient cityscape. - Shanghu Scenic Area: ★★★★★ Whether it's the stunning mountain and water scenery, the story-filled Fushui Mountain Villa, or the magical Water Forest, all will captivate you. - Western City Tower Scenic Area of Yushan: ★★★★ Numerous ancient relics complement the majestic city walls, displaying historical changes and cultural heritage.
